What you will be doing

You’ll be responsible for treating and preventing minor injuries and illnesses. They will provide information and guidance for the promotion of good health and well-being of our students.

Essential functions

  • Treat minor injuries and illnesses according to physician instructions as authorized per healthcare guidelines.
  • Clean and dress wounds, operate emergency equipment, and provide follow up care, as required.
  • Prepare and administer specified medication and drugs.
  • Review and audit all assigned areas regularly for contractual compliance and effectiveness of delivery of services to student. Prepare related reports.
  • Monitor students on bed rest in health and wellness center.
  • Enter required information in student health records and maintain in an organized manner.

Education and Experience Requirements

  • Valid, unencumbered LPN license in the state of Kentucky with two (2) years practical nursing experience required.
  • Experience with youth.
  • Valid driver’s license with acceptable driving record required.
